Science Favors Fasting 
What are the benefits of fasting? Scientists have studied the effects of fasting on the body and found that the intake of food increases the body’s metabolism. After fasting, metabolism can become as much as 22 percent lower than the normal rate. Research has also shown that after long periods of fasting, the body tends to adjust itself by lowering the rate of metabolism itself. After fasting, a person should gradually resume eating. 
In some studies performed on fasting Muslims, it was observed that there was a slight loss of weight both in males and females. Their blood glucose levels increased significantly. Other parameters such as blood levels of cortisol, testosterone, sodium, potassium, urea, total cholesterol, HDL (high density lipoprotein), TG (triglycerides), and serum osmolatity did  not show notable variations.   
Another study performed about a decade ago in Iran showed that sporadic restraint from food and drink for about 17 hours a day for 30 days does not alter male reproductive hormones, HPTA (hypothalamic-pituitary-thyroid-axis) or peripheral metabolism of thyroid hormones. Any changes noticed return to normal four weeks after fasting.  
Dr. Jalila El Ati and her associates ("Increased fat oxidation during Ramadan fasting in healthy women: an adaptive mechanism for body-weight maintanence." Am. J. Clin. Nutri. August 1995), who investigated the possible effects of Ramadan fasting of anthropometric and metabolic variables in healthy Tunisian Muslim women, found that the total daily energy intake remained unchanged whereas the qualitative components of nutrients were markedly affected. Ramadan fasting influenced neither body weight or body composition. Results also indicate respiratory and energy expenditure during Ramadan. Fat oxidation was increased and carbohydrate oxidation was decreased during the light span of nycthemeron.  
In non-Muslim countries such as the U.S. the physicians, particularly the family physicians and internists should be aware of changes of glucose and bilirubin during the month of Ramadan. 
Fasting may enhance mucosa derived B lymphocyte cell responsiveness while having no effect on B cell responsiveness in both rheumatoid arthritis patients and healthy volunteers. In a study, after a three-day, water-only fast, 7 rheumatoid arthritis patients and 17 healthy volunteers received influenza virus vaccine either orally or by injection. When the blood samples were analyzed for B lymphocyte response a week later, it was found that Blymphocyte response was enhanced in the group receiving the vaccine orally in both arthritis patients and volunteers. The response to injected vaccine was unchanged in both groups. 
Fasting helps Longevity 
Studies on laboratory animals have shown that restriction of caloric intake increases longevity, slows the rate of functional decline, and reduces incidence of age-related disease in a variety of species. The mechanism of action of caloric restriction remains unknown; however, data suggest that cellular functions are altered in such a way that destructive by-products of metabolism are reduced, and defense or repair systems are enhanced by this nutritional manipulation. Animal and human studies suggest potential benefits of dietary modification, exercise, antioxidants, hormones, and deprenyl. 
Fasting and Lactating Mothers 
The effects of fasting and increased blood insulin and glucose on milk volume and composition were studies with glucose clamp methodology in exclusively and partially breast-feeding women (producing no more than 200 ml milk per day). There was no effect of milk volume, milk glucose concentration, and total fat content or lactose secretion rate. It is concluded that human milk production is isolated from the homeostatic mechanisms that regulate glucose metabolism in the rest of the body, in part because the lactose synthetase system has a Km for glucose lower than the concentration available in the Golgi compartment. 
In a study which investigated the effects of a short-term fast (72 hours) on female reproductive hormone secretion and menstrual function, it was concluded that in spite of profound metabolic changes, a 72-hour fast during the follicular phase does not affect the menstrual cycle of normal cycling women.

Comets of Ice

Comets orbiting a distant star have been discovered to contain water. In the Journal Nature dated July 12, 2001 scientists claimed that it is the first time the ingredient considered key to life has been discovered in objects circling a star other than our sun which is also a star. This discovery supports the theory that other planetary systems may be similar to our own solar system and may contain chemicals that are essential to the formation of life, as we know it. This particular star is identified as CW Leonis and is located some 3,000 trillion miles from Earth in the constellation Leo. Scientists have no way of knowing whether life ever existed on any comets or planets orbiting this particular star. One conclusion is that no life could exist there now. The reason for this conclusion is that this star has burned out the last of its nuclear fuel and the star has swelled and increased in luminosity, engulfing nearby objects and melting comets in orbits as distant as Neptune is from our own sun -- releasing the water that astronomers spotted using a radio-telescope in outer space. 
Gary Melnic, chief scientist on the project and an astronomer at the Harvard-Smithsonian Center for Astrophysics in Cambridge, Massachusetts, regrets that the existence of these bodies is measured through their destruction. He says that there could have been water closer to the star, bolstering the idea that life may have existed outside our solar system. Scientists have believed that the comets helped build life on earth. The comets along with important chemicals bring the water in our oceans as they hurtled through earth's atmosphere. 
The amount of water estimated from the distant comets is about 10 times the mass of earth. By peeking at the dying star far in the distance and therefore long in the past, scientists said they had also glimpsed for the first time a vision of the fiery future of our won world. As our sun begins to die in about 6 billion years, it will also first grow larger and hotter, vaporizing earth's oceans, reducing planets and comets to cinders. Scientists have never before seen the effects of a dying star on its surroundings, although the process is not thought to be uncommon. Every star in the galaxies comprising of billion stars in the universe will go though similar cycles of destruction.

GLOSSARY
Comets
Appearance:
Seeing a comet with the naked eye is a somewhat rare occurrence. On the average we get a naked-eye comet once every five or six years and this includes comets that become barely visible to the naked eye. Classic comets with long tails only appear about once every 10-12 years. The motion is very difficult to detect and comparing its place with naked-eye stars over several days is the only way to see it move. In general, comets are best observed with telescopes or binoculars.
    What are They?
Comets are primarily composed of ice and dust, causing some astronomers to refer to them as "dirty snowballs." They typically move through the solar system in orbits ranging from a few years to several hundred thousand years. Comets are not on fire. As they approach the sun, the sun's heat melts the comet's ices and releases dust particles, which are most evident as the comet's tail. Comets rarely come within a few million miles of Earth and, thus, have a slow apparent motion across our sky. Typical comets remain visible for periods of several weeks up to several months.
    Meteors
    Appearance:
Meteors appear as fast-moving streaks of light in the night sky. They are frequently referred to as "falling stars" or "shooting stars." Most are white or blue-white in appearance, although other frequent colors are yellow, orange. The colors seem more related to the speed of the meteor rather than composition. Red meteors occasionally appear as very long streaks and are usually indicative of a meteor that is skimming the atmosphere. Green meteors are also occasionally seen and are usually very bright. The green color may be a result of ionized oxygen.
    What are They?
Meteoroids are the smallest particles orbiting the sun, and most are no larger than grains of sand. From years of studying the evolution of meteor streams, astronomers have concluded that comets produced clouds of meteoroids orbiting the sun. Meteoroids can not be observed moving through space because of their small size. Over the years numerous man-made satellites recovered by manned spacecraft have shown pits in their metal skins, which were caused by the impact of meteoroids.
Meteoroids become visible to observers on Earth when they enter Earth's atmosphere. They are then referred to as meteors. They become visible as a result of friction caused by air molecules slamming against the surface of the high-velocity particle. The friction typically causes meteors to glow blue or white, although other colors have been reported. Most meteors completely burn up in the atmosphere at altitudes of between 60 and 80 miles. They are rarely seen for periods of more than a few seconds.
Occasionally, a large meteor will not burn up completely as it moves through Earth's atmosphere. The subsequent pieces that fall to Earth's surface are known as meteorites.
    Asteroids
    Appearance:
Out of more than 10 thousand numbered asteroids, only Vesta has consistently been a naked-eye object if the observer has extremely dark skies and the asteroid is moving in relatively star-poor regions of the sky. The motion of asteroids is similar to that of comets in that the position must be plotted on a star chart over two or three days for motion to be detected.
    What are They?
Asteroids, or minor planets, have been described as "mountains in space." They are large rocks typically ranging from a few feet to several hundred miles across. The vast majority of asteroids move between the orbits of Mars and Jupiter in what is commonly called the "asteroid belt." They always appear starlike and their motion with respect to the stars is usually so slow that several hours may pass before any movement is noticed. Most asteroids within the asteroid belt never come closer than 100 million miles from Earth, but there are some asteroids which come close to and even cross Earth's orbit. These objects can occasionally pass within a few million miles of Earth, and even within the orbit of the moon, and then exhibit a rapid motion that is discernible after only a few minutes. Asteroids within the asteroid belt can be observed every year, while the ones passing especially close to Earth may only be visible for a few weeks or months.

The origin of universe has been explained by several cosmological theories. One theory that seems philosophically far more attractive is called the Steady-State model. This theory was proposed in the 1940s by Herman Bondi, Thomas Gold and Fred Hoyle. They stated that the universe has always been just about the same as it is now. As it expands, new matter is continually created to fill up the gaps between the galaxies.  
This theory has been replaced by the "Standard Model" or the "Big Bang" Theory. Using the Doppler effect the astronomers confirmed that the galaxies are moving away and that the universe is expanding. The birth of the universe has been estimated to be between 15 and 30 billion years ago.
 
The experimental confirmation of the Big Bang Theory came from the detection of the Cosmic Microwave Radiation Background by a pair of radio astronomers, Arno. A. Penzias and Robert W. Wilson. In 1964 they were working in the Bell Telephone Laboratory which had in its possession of an unusual radio antenna on Crawford Hill at Holmdel, New Jersey. By measuring the cosmic microwave radiation background radiation which is the noise left over from the early universe, they calculated the temperature in the universe to be 3.5 degrees Kelvin.
 
In the beginning there was an explosion. This explosion is not the same as one observes on earth. As a result of this explosion, space and time were born and started to expand to this day, and they will continue to expand in the future. The temperature of the universe was about a hundred thousand million degrees Centigrade. It is so hot than none of the components of ordinary matter molecules, or atoms or even the nuclei of atoms, could have held together. In the early universe there was abundance of electrons,
Positrons (anti-electron) and neutrinos, ghostly particles with no mass or electric charge. Finally, the universe was filled with light. Light consists of particles of zero mass and zero electrical charge known as photons. The number and the average energy of the photons was about the same as for electrons, positrons or neutrinos. These particles were continually being created out of pure energy (original source of all matter in the present-day universe-galaxies, nebulae, stars, planets, earth, etc.).
 
As the time passed and the temperature of the universe cooled, nucleosynthesis took place and hydrogen and helium and other heavy elements were formed. After 3 minutes of the Big Bang, the universe consisted of 73 percent hydrogen and 27 percent helium. The resulting gases under the influence of gravitation ultimately condensed to form the galaxies and stars of the present universe.

Quantum Mechanics 
Quantum Mechanics is a branch of physics, which deals with the behavior of matter and light on the atomic and subatomic scale. Its concept frequently conflicts with common sense notions. The business of Quantum Mechanics is to describe and account for the world-on the small scale-actually and not as we imagine it or would like it to be. The world of Quantum Mechanics is strange, fascinating, mysterious and very intellectual. On the other hand the word "Quantum Mechanics" is repelling, boring, uninteresting and very dull. Most of us shy away from the word Quantum Mechanics, whenever it is mentioned. 
Consider for example the “classical” atom, i.e. the solar system model of the atom as introduced by Rutherford in 1911. The basic flaw with this “classical” atom is that as the orbiting electron circles the nucleus, it should emit electromagnetic waves of an intensity increasing rapidly to infinity in a tiny
fraction of a second, as it spirals inwards and plunges into the nucleus. However, nothing like this is observed. Thus our observation contradicts our “classical” physics theory. This is why Quantum theory, which certainly was not wished upon by scientists, was forced upon them despite their great reluctance. They found themselves driven into this strange, and in many ways, philosophically unsatisfying view of the world. 
Thanks God the real world is neither entirely classical nor quantum. On the “large” scale, the world seems to behave rationally according to the classical theory. However as you go “smaller”, it starts to act in a strange, peculiar way to save itself from extinction.  
Now what if we were living in an entirely classical (non-quantum) world? 
The answer is simple. There would be no world, classical or other, to live in. In a purely classical world, the atoms would not exist, as the electrons would be sucked into the nucleus, transforming the world into a concentrated, dense material, in a fraction of a second. 
One might say that since this awkward quantum theory deals with the very “tiny”, who cares?

Wrong. As a matter of fact the very existence of solid bodies, the strength and physical properties of materials, the nature of chemistry, the colors of substances, the phenomena of freezing and boiling, the reliability of inheritance, these, and many familiar properties, require the quantum theory for their explanations.

 
The World without the knowledge of Quantum Mechanics 
On the other hand, quantum theory has been an outstanding successful theory and underlies nearly all of modern science and technology. It governs the behavior of transistors and integrated circuits, which are the essential components of electronics devices such as television and computers, as mentioned earlier, and is also the basis of modern chemistry and biology. In short, it is almost impossible to imagine the modern world without the contributions of quantum theory. Quantum theory as we know it today arouse out of two independent later schemes which were innovated by a pair of young remarkable physicists: a 24 year old German, Werner Heisenberg, and an Austrian, Erwin Schrodinger. Heisenberg's uncertainty principle proves that nature does not allow us to measure the position and velocity of a single particle (let alone the whole universe) with perfection, no matter how precise our measuring instruments. Schrodinger developed what is known as Schrodinger equation. This equation states that there is a wave associated with any particle (like the electron), and it is called the wavefunction and it is spread out to fill the whole universe. The wavefunction is stronger in one region, which corresponds to the position of the particle and gets weaker farther away from this region but still exists even far away from the "position" of the particle. Schrodinger equation is very good at predicting how particles like electrons behave under different circumstances.

DUAL ASPECTS
 
The subatomic units of matter are very abstract entities, which have a dual aspect. Depending on how we look at them, they appear sometimes as particles, sometimes as waves; and this dual nature is also exhibited by light which can take the form of electromagnetic waves or of particles. It seems impossible to accept that something can be, at the same time, a particle-i.e., an entity confined to a very small volume-and a wave, which is spread out over a large region of space. This contradiction gave rise to the formulation of the quantum theory. Max Planck discovered that the energy of heat radiation is not emitted continuously, but appears in the form of "energy packets." Einstein called these energy packets "quanta" (quantum is singular) and recognized them as a fundamental aspect of nature. The light quanta are called photons, which are massless and always travel with the speed of light.

A PARTICLE AT TWO PLACES AT THE SAME TIME 
Let us assume that we are studying the position of a light photon traveling in space. It has been shown that this photon has a wavefunction as introduced by Schrodinger equation. The wavefunction peaks at the position of the photon. Now if this photon encounters a half-silvered mirror, tilted at 45° to the light beam (a half-silvered mirror is a mirror, which reflects exactly half of the light, which impinges upon it, while the remaining half is transmitted directly through the mirror), the photon's wavefunction splits into two, with one part reflected off to the side and the other part continuing in the same direction in which the photon started. The wavefunction is said to be "doubly peaked." Since each "part" of the wavefunction is describing a position that may be light-years away from the other position given by the other "part" of the wavefunction, we can conclude that the photon has found itself to be in two places at once, more than a light-year distant from one another!

Someone might say that this previous assessment is not real. What is happening really is that the photon has a 50 percent probability that it is in one of the places and a 50 percent probability that it is in the other? No, that's simply not true! No matter for how long it has traveled, there is always the possibility that the two parts of the photons' beam may be reflected back so that they encounter one another, for a much awaited "reunion". If it was a simple matter of probability, the photon would be either on one position "OR" the other, and there would not be any need for "reunion" with the other probability.

So as long as there is any possibility that the wavefunction will be reduced to one peak again (as it was before the photon hit the half-silvered mirror); the photon in question shall behave as one photon in two places at the same time!
 
In the experiment presented here, a light beam encounters a half-silvered mirror angled 45° to the light beam, splitting the beam into two. The two parts of this light beam is brought back again to the same point (where a second half-silvered mirror is placed) by using a pair of fully-silvered mirrors .Two photocells (A & B) are placed in the direct line of the two beams in order to find the where about of the examined photon. What do we find? If it were merely the case that there were a 50 % chance that the photon followed one route and a 50 % chance that it followed the other, then we should find a 50 % probability that one of the detectors registers the photon and a 50 % probability that the other one does. However, that is not what happens. If the two possible routes are exactly equal in length, then it turns out that there is a 100 % probability that the photon reaches the detector A, lying in the direction of the photon's initial motion and a 0 % probability that it reaches the other detector B (the photon is certain to strike detector A).  
What does this tell us about the reality of the photon's state of existence between its first and last encounter with a half-reflecting mirror? It seems inescapable that the photon must, in some sense have actually traveled both routes at once! For if an absorbing screen is placed in the way of either of the two routes, then it becomes equally probable that A or B is reached; but when both routes are open (and of equal length) only A can be reached. Blocking off one of the routes actually allows B to be reached! With both routes open, the photon somehow "knows" that it is not permitted to reach B, so it must have actually felt out both routes. SCHRODINGER'S CAT 
What happens if we designed an experiment where a quantum event would have a direct impact on a large object like…a cat! 
Imagine a sealed container, so perfectly constructed that no physical influence can pass either inwards or outwards across its walls. With the cat inside the container, there is also a device that can be triggered by some quantum event. The quantum event is the triggering of a photocell by a photon, where the photon had been emitted by some light source, and then reflected off a half-silvered mirror. The reflection at the mirror splits the photon quantum state (wave function) into two separate parts; one of which is reflected and the other is transmitted through the mirror. The reflected part of the photon wave function is focused on the photocell, so if the photons are registered by the photocell, it has been reflected .In that case, the cyanide is released and the cat is killed. If the photocell doesn't register, the photon was transmitted through the half-silvered mirror to the wall behind, and the cat is safe.

Now, let us take the viewpoint of the physicist outside the container. According to the outside observer, no "measurement" has actually taken place, so the quantum state of the entire system is nothing but a linear superposition between alternatives right up to the scale of the cat (Schrödinger equation). Both alternatives must be present in the state. So, according to the outside observer, the cat is in a linear superposition of being dead and alive at the same time! What is the Reality?
